1. Understand the Value of Gold
The first step in preparing gold for sale is understanding its value. Gold’s worth is determined by its purity, weight, and the current market price. Gold purity is measured in karats, with 24-karat gold being the purest form.
Steps to Determine Value:
- Check the Karat: Look for the karat marking, usually found on the inside of rings or on the clasps of necklaces and bracelets.
- Weigh Your Gold: Use a precise scale to determine the weight of your gold in grams or ounces.
- Research Market Prices: Stay updated with the current gold prices, which fluctuate daily.
2. Sort and Separate Your Gold
An essential part of preparing gold for sale is sorting and separating different types of gold. This categorization helps in assessing the value accurately.
Sorting Tips:
- Group by Karat: Separate your gold items by their karat value —24K, 18K, 14K, etc.
- Identify Mixed Metals: Ensure you separate gold pieces that are mixed with other metals or contain gemstones.
- Verify Authenticity: Use a magnet to check for non-gold materials; real gold is not magnetic.

3. Clean Your Gold
Cleaning your gold jewelry can enhance its appearance and increase its appeal to buyers. Dirty or tarnished pieces may be undervalued, so proper cleaning is a crucial step in preparing gold for sale.
Cleaning Tips:
- Use Mild Soap and Water: Mix a few drops of dish soap with warm water. Soak the gold for a few minutes and gently scrub with a soft brush.
- Rinse and Dry: Rinse thoroughly with warm water and dry with a soft, lint-free cloth.
-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Steer clear of using bleach or other strong chemicals that may damage your gold.
4. Get a Professional Appraisal
Obtaining a professional appraisal is a key step in preparing gold for sale. An expert appraisal can give you an accurate valuation of your gold items based on their weight, purity, and condition.
Why Get an Appraisal:
- Accurate Valuation: Certified appraisers provide a precise valuation, ensuring you receive a fair price.
- Understand Market Trends: Appraisers offer insights into market trends, helping you decide if it’s the right time to sell.

7. Finalize the Sale
Once you’ve selected the best offer, it’s time to finalize the sale. Ensure all terms are clear and agreed upon before proceeding.
Finalization Steps:
- Verify the Offer: Double-check the buyer’s offer to confirm it reflects the agreed price and terms.
- Complete the Transaction: Choose a safe payment method, ideally one that provides proof of transaction, like a bank transfer or cashier’s check.
- Document the Sale: Keep records of all communications and documentation related to the sale for future reference.
